HPE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review

785 of the 5,745 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Hewlett Packard (HPE)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$15.8B — down 6.2% from $16.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 102 funds opened new HPE posit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 38 holders — while 296 added to existing stakes and 217 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Invesco, adding an estimated $82.9M. The largest seller was Dodge & Cox, cutting an estimated $654M.
